I do not think that it would be right for discussions between myself and the Crown Agents about the development of their policy to be reported to parliament. I do not believe that that would be in the interests of the relationship between the Crown Agents and the principals. To an extent that must be a confidential relationship. It would be wrong for such matters to be discussed in Parliament because this relationship between the Crown Agents and the principals would be gravely undermined.
